Innocent Woman’s Name Linked to January 6 Pipe Bombs
Share on FacebookShare on Twitter



A federal security officer, initially linked to the thwarted Jan. 6 pipe bomb attack, cleared her name with video evidence of her playing with puppies at the time the bombs were placed. The FBI has ruled her out as a suspect after her name circulated online, raising concerns among Trump administration officials about the process leading to this identification. A draft memo from the Office of the Director of National Intelligence (ODNI) implicated her based on a tip and alleged gait analysis. Gabbard, the ODNI director, distanced herself from the memo, which had not been officially approved.
